Condition
There are some small occasional chipping to the edges of the books, mostly to the curved page ends and to the base.
The upper book: There is a crack running down the side of the back cover at its midpoint. The right bottom corner of the front cover has a small chip. There is a restored 1 by 1/2 inch flat chip to the upper left corner of the front cover.
The base, which is formed as another book, has two haircracks running on the sides, one approximately 1-1/2 inch long, the other approximately 5 inches running upwards and then parallel to the base and forking into another direction.
